New York: Foreign investors may further dump Indian assets after the Mumbai attacks and worry over tension with Pakistan, but the impact will be limited and Western firms facing recession at home remain keen to tap the subcontinent's growth.
Two hotels heavily used by foreign businessmen were at the centre of last week's attack in which 10 terrorist killed more than 180 people.
